The blast hoses market is a crucial component of various industrial operations where abrasive materials are propelled at high speed to prepare or clean surfaces. Key applications of blast hoses include mining plants, shipyards, construction sites, and other industrial environments. These hoses are designed to withstand high pressures and abrasive materials, ensuring efficiency and safety in demanding work settings. With advancements in hose material and design, these hoses provide the necessary durability and flexibility for a wide range of blasting operations, such as sandblasting, shotblasting, and other surface preparation techniques. The demand for these hoses is expanding due to increased industrial activity in sectors like mining, construction, and shipbuilding, where surface cleaning and coating applications are essential for maintaining equipment and infrastructure longevity.
In mining plants, blast hoses play a vital role in maintaining machinery and preparing surfaces for coating or corrosion protection. Mining operations, which often involve abrasive materials like sand or coal dust, require high-quality blast hoses capable of handling heavy wear and tear. These hoses must offer superior abrasion resistance, flexibility, and the ability to endure high-pressure environments for extended periods. Their use in mining facilities extends to tasks such as cleaning metal surfaces, removing rust, and preparing surfaces for coatings that can withstand harsh outdoor environments. The surge in global mining activities and the increasing demand for mineral resources have significantly boosted the requirement for robust and reliable blast hoses in this industry.
In shipyards, blast hoses are essential for surface preparation, particularly for cleaning large ship structures and equipment. The application of blast hoses in shipyards is often associated with removing rust, old paint, and other contaminants from metal surfaces to prepare for new coatings. Given the challenging marine environment, where saltwater exposure accelerates corrosion, shipbuilding and maintenance industries rely on efficient and high-performance blasting systems. These hoses must endure high pressures and abrasive forces, ensuring optimal surface finish for protection against corrosion and extending the life of vessels. As the global shipping industry continues to grow, so does the demand for durable and effective blast hoses in shipyards, reinforcing the importance of maintaining safety and structural integrity.
Construction sites are another key application area for blast hoses, where they are employed for surface preparation, cleaning, and coating of various structures, such as bridges, buildings, and roads. In this context, blast hoses are used for sandblasting to remove contaminants, old paint, and debris from surfaces to prepare them for new layers of paint or protective coatings. The increasing focus on infrastructure development and renovation projects across the world has led to a growing demand for blast hoses on construction sites. Furthermore, as the construction industry continues to embrace advanced technologies, there is an increasing need for high-performance blast hoses that offer precision, durability, and high resistance to wear, allowing operators to deliver high-quality results safely and efficiently.

1. What are blast hoses used for?
Blast hoses are primarily used for surface preparation by delivering abrasive materials at high pressure to clean or finish surfaces in various industrial applications.
2. Which industries rely on blast hoses?
Industries such as mining, shipbuilding, construction, and metalworking use blast hoses for tasks like surface cleaning, rust removal, and coating preparation.
3. How do blast hoses differ from other industrial hoses?
Blast hoses are specifically designed to withstand high pressure, abrasion, and chemical exposure, unlike standard industrial hoses that may not have the same durability.
4. What materials are blast hoses typically made of?
Blast hoses are usually made from rubber, polyurethane, or a combination of materials to provide flexibility, durability, and resistance to wear and tear from abrasive materials.
